During the 2020-2021 academic year, Flagler College - St Augustine handed out 40 bachelor's degrees in natural resources & conservation. This is an increase of 3% over the previous year when 39 degrees were handed out.

Flagler St. Augustine Natural Resources & Conservation Bachelor’s Program

The natural resources & conservation program at Flagler St. Augustine awarded 40 bachelor's degrees in 2020-2021. About 20% of these degrees went to men with the other 80% going to women.

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Flagler St. Augustine are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 88% of students fell into this category.
